Core KPIs

Output Impact ($)

Total value of goods/services generated by housing operations and spending. 

Employment Impact (Jobs)

Full-time, part-time, and seasonal positions are supported directly/indirectly.

Economic Impact ($)

Total household income generated or supported in the local economy.

Value-Added Impact ($)

Contribution to regional GDP (GRP) from direct, indirect, and induced effects. 

Supplemental KPIs

Homelessness Rate Reduction (%)

Measures the reduction in regional homelessness attributable to PHA housing access or supportive programs.

Capital Investment Leveraged ($)

Quantifies non-federal or private capital leveraged through public housing investment and redevelopment projects.

Resident Employment Rate (%)

Share of employable residents currently in the workforce or job training programs.

Resident Income Growth (%)

Average percentage increase in household income among residents participating in workforce or self-sufficiency programs.

Local Vendor Participation Rate (%)

Portion of total PHA expenditures spent with local or regional vendors.

Affordable Housing Unit Expansion (# or %)

Net increase in affordable housing units through construction, rehabilitation, or preservation.

Resident Satisfaction Index (Score)

Composite score derived from resident surveys assessing safety, quality, and access to opportunity.

Community Revitalization Impact ($)

Estimated secondary economic benefits of neighborhood stabilization and revitalization projects led by the PHA.

Energy Efficiency Savings ($)

Value of utility and energy cost savings resulting from capital improvements and modernization efforts.

Resident Retention Rate (%)

Percentage of residents who remain in stable PHA-managed housing across fiscal years.
